Sound Quality that Speaks for Itself
Completely new designed speakers have up to twice the dynamic range as before and up to 58 percent higher volume. The bass is even twice as loud as before and because they are directly connected to the system power supply, they can easily reach up to three times the peak performance. Therefore, MacBook Pro is an excellent choice when you want to quickly mix recordings, edit video, or watch movies on the go.

The Most Powerful and Versatile Port
The Thunderbolt 3 is an universal port that connects the enormous bandwidth and outstanding versatility with the USB-C. One connector, with a throughput of 40 Gb/s - twice that of the Thunderbolt 2 - transmits data, power, and video in record speed. Since both the sides of the MacBook Pro have ports available, you can choose from which side you want to plug in. Existing devices can easily be joined by cable or adapter. The Thunderbolt 3 is also reversible, so any adapter will do.

The size of RAM is one of the most important factors affecting overall computer performance. RAM serves as temporary storage for the data that the computer processes. The more RAM a computer has, the more tasks it can process simultaneously without slowing down. 8 GB of RAM is often considered the minimum for most tasks, while demanding applications such as games and professional graphic design or video editing software may require 16 GB of RAM or more.
Processor frequency, often referred to as clock speed, is a key indicator of processor performance. It is measured in gigahertz (GHz) and represents how many operations a processor can perform per second. Higher frequency generally means higher performance, but it can also lead to higher power consumption. It is important to find the right balance between performance and efficiency for your specific needs.
The type of storage in a laptop can have a significant impact on its performance and price. The two most common types are Hard Disk Drive (HDD) and Solid State Drive (SSD). HDD is an older technology with moving parts and provides a large amount of storage space at a low cost. SSDs are faster, quieter and more reliable, but generally more expensive.
